What is Cannabis 21?

Cannabis 21 typically refers to a dispensary or retailer that specializes in selling cannabis products to adults who are 21 years of age or older, in compliance with state laws. These establishments offer a variety of marijuana products, including flowers, edibles, concentrates, and topicals. Customers may need to show valid identification to verify their age before making a purchase. Cannabis 21 stores often provide information and guidance to help customers choose products that suit their needs.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a cannabis dispensary associate,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Cannabis Dispensary Associate, you need strong product knowledge, attention to compliance regulations, and excellent customer service skills,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with point-of-sale systems, inventory management software, and state-mandated tracking systems like METRC is typically required. Outstanding communication, professionalism, and the ability to educate customers about products make someone stand out in this role. These skills are crucial for ensuring legal compliance, building customer trust, and maintaining efficient daily operations in a regulated industry.

What are some common challenges faced by employees working in a cannabis dispensary like Cannabis 21, and how can they be addressed?

Working in a cannabis dispensary such as Cannabis 21 often involves staying updated with rapidly changing regulations and ensuring strict compliance in all transactions. Employees may face challenges like managing high customer volumes, educating consumers on product options, and handling inventory control with accuracy. Building strong communication skills and product knowledge can help address these challenges, as can being proactive about ongoing compliance training and teamwork. Many dispensaries also provide mentorship and advancement opportunities for employees who demonstrate reliability and a commitment to customer service.

Job description

CD Staffing is excited to partner with Off The Charts (OTC) to find exceptional candidates. Off The Charts is growing, and we're looking for experienced budtenders who can assist in supporting our guests.

Candidates must be knowledgeable connoisseur with the expertise to educate and assist guests with their unique needs, preferences, and budgets while bringing a positive, "CAN DO" attitude to join our fast-paced team.

Responsibilities:

  • Excellent attendance must be on time for every shift.
  • Ensure all guests are greeted as they arrive and when they depart with a smile.
  • Maintain expert-level knowledge on our full product catalog as well as the latest trends in the cannabis industry.
  • Answer guests' questions regarding the different strains of cannabis, their medicinal uses, and methods of consumption.
  • Educating guests on the safe use of selected cannabis products.
  • Processing guests' payments correctly and ensuring you are using proper money handling skills and using the dispensary's Point of Sale (POS) system.
  • Keeping the storefront clean and tidy.
  • Labeling products correctly.
  • Verifying guests are of appropriate age.
  • Making sure the floor is adequately stocked.
  • Communicate with management if any issues were to arise.
  • Any additional tasks as assigned.

Requirement/Skills/Knowledge:

  • 1-2 years sales experience, preferably in the service or cannabis industry
  • 1-2 years Customer Service experience
  • 1-2 years Budtending experience a plus
  • Attention to Detail and organized
  • Must be able to work in a fast-paced environment
  • Must meet the legal age requirements to work in cannabis (21 years and older)
  • Must pass LiveScan or other city mandated background check
  • Strong work ethics
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Effective communication skills
  • Exceptional customer service skills
